This year's "Tübinger Sozialpädagogiktag" - a yearly conference gathering scholars and practitioners at the Institute for Educational Science of the University of Tübingen - is entitled "Life course-related support in Europe - Learning from diversity and differences in practice". It takes place on 23 and 24 November 2007.
Barbara Stauber's contribution is "Life course, biography, transitions - what should services be based on?". Andreas Waltherwill give a talk on "Which kind of support do you get? Life course regimes in Europe in comparative perspective". Axel Pohl will be inputting into a working group on "Youth and Migration: what does integration mean?" |
